AEW posted a pair of backstage promos as fallout to Dynamite (Apr. 17, 2024) that are worth watching for character development. Deonna Purrazzo has a problem with Thunder Rosa, and Shane Taylor Promotions explains their winning mentality.

After Deonna Purrazzo defeated Mariah May, Toni Storm stomped the Virtuosa. Thunder Rosa ran out to even the odds, and Purrazzo didn’t take kindly to Thunder butting in. Now, Purrazzo has a problem with Thunder. The Virtuosa warned La Mera Mera that she has no hesitation confronting her face to face.

Ooh, this beef is getting juicy. Thunder was rude last week getting uppity at Purrazzo just trying to help, so it makes sense for Purrazzo to return the same disdain. Icing on the cake was the two-handed fongool gesture from Purrazzo in that promo. She isn’t messing around. This story is selling toward a fight I want to see.

Shane Taylor Promotions have been on the losing side often, however, their mentality is to win or learn. They take pride in standing tall in the end laying out opponents after the match. Taylor warned the locker room that they might win the match, but STP won’t lose the fight. Rumble, bad man, rumble.

I like this attitude from STP. Those talking points make them come across like badasses instead of losers, as the record often reflects. It provides a reason for fans to get invested in their growth. That tough talk has me yearning for faction warfare against the likes of Los Ingobernables, House of Black, and so on.
